Ethereum Gas Fee Revenue Reaches $2.48 Billion in 2024, Ranked First in Blockchain Rankings
On January 22, according to data released by Coingecko, Ethereum ranked first in the blockchain rankings with $2.48 billion in gas fee revenue in 2024, followed by Tron with $2.15 billion, and Bitcoin ranked third with $922.89 million. The report pointed out that in 2024, L1 and L2 blockchains received a total of more than $6.89 billion in transaction fees, of which L1 chain revenue was $6.6 billion and L2 chain revenue was $294.92 million.
